Defining Game Design Workshops: A Hands-On Approach
At its core, a game design workshop is an intensive, interactive educational session explicitly designed to produce a specialized, tangible outcome through direct participant engagement. Drawing from the broader concept of workshops, as defined by organizations like Lucid Meetings, these sessions prioritize active participation over passive observation. In the context of game development, this translates into structured, interactive learning experiences where participants are actively involved in creating, analyzing, and refining game prototypes. Led by experienced facilitators, often industry veterans or leading educators, these workshops leverage proven methodologies and tools for rapid prototyping and iterative playtesting. This approach helps participants build robust foundations in various facets of game creation, including core game design principles, introductory game programming concepts, visual design integration, and user interface (UI) development. Critically, workshops foster an environment where collaboration is paramount, experimentation is encouraged, and mistakes are reframed as invaluable learning opportunities.
Game design workshops exhibit considerable variation in format and scope. mirroring the diverse needs of the learning community. Options range from immersive, in-person experiences held in dedicated studios, university labs, or community innovation hubs, to highly flexible online setups accessible from virtually any location. While in-person formats facilitate direct, immediate engagement and often provide access to specialized equipment, online workshops offer unparalleled accessibility, breaking down geographical barriers and allowing for diverse participation. Regardless of the delivery method, their fundamental purpose remains consistent: to serve as a vital bridge between abstract theoretical knowledge and concrete practical application. Some workshops cater to beginners, introducing core concepts such as game mechanics, narrative arcs, and player experience design over a few hours or days. Others delve into intermediate to advanced topics, focusing on specialized areas like intricate level design, complex system balancing, or sophisticated game UI design, often spanning several days or even weeks to allow for deeper exploration and project development.

Essential Toolkit for Aspiring Workshop Participants
Beyond a reliable laptop or a powerful desktop computer, several software tools are indispensable for a productive game design workshop experience, enabling participants to transform abstract ideas into playable realities:
- Game Engines: These are fundamental for prototyping and bringing game concepts to life. Popular choices include Godot Engine, often favored by beginners for its open-source nature and ease of entry; Unity, a versatile and widely adopted engine suitable for a vast array of game types; and Unreal Engine, renowned for its high-fidelity graphics and robust toolset, particularly in AAA development. Familiarity with at least one engine is highly advantageous.
- Design and Asset Creation Software: Visual elements are crucial to game appeal. Software like Figma (for UI/UX design and wireframing), Autodesk Maya or Blender (for 3D modeling and animation), and the Adobe Creative Suite (Photoshop, Illustrator for 2D assets, textures, and graphic design) are commonly used. These tools allow participants to create characters, environments, user interfaces, and other visual components.
- Debugging and Code Editors: For workshops involving programming, debugging tools are critical to ensure functionality and identify errors. Integrated Development Environments (IDEs) like Visual Studio Code or JetBrains Rider offer comprehensive features for coding, debugging, and project management.
- Collaboration and Project Management Tools: Especially vital for online or team-based workshops, platforms like Miro (for virtual whiteboarding and brainstorming), Trello or Jira (for task management and workflow organization), and Discord or Slack (for real-time communication) facilitate seamless teamwork and project coordination. "Effective collaboration tools are non-negotiable in modern game development," notes project manager Lena Schmidt. "They streamline communication and keep teams aligned, whether remote or in-person."

Engaging Activities in Game Design Workshops
The effectiveness of game design workshops largely stems from their dynamic activities, which actively engage participants and foster both skill application and creative exploration:

- Brainstorming and Ideation Sessions: These often begin in small groups, encouraging the free exchange of ideas. Such sessions promote critical thinking, active participation, and cultivate a supportive learning environment where every idea is given consideration. Techniques like mind-mapping, rapid ideation, and concept sketching are frequently employed.
- Role-Playing Exercises: Participants often step into various roles within a simulated development team (e.g., lead designer, programmer, artist, quality assurance tester). This provides a broader understanding of each team member’s contribution and how individual decisions impact the overall project, fostering empathy and cross-functional awareness.
- Prototyping and Iteration Sprints: Central to workshops, these activities involve rapidly building simplified versions of game mechanics or levels. Participants learn to quickly test concepts, identify flaws, and iterate on their designs. This agile approach is critical for refining gameplay and improving the final product’s quality.
- Playtesting and Feedback Circles: Once prototypes are developed, participants engage in playtesting, often observing peers playing their creations. Structured feedback sessions follow, where constructive criticism is exchanged, and actionable insights are gathered. This directly simulates user testing and quality assurance processes.
- Design Documentation: Workshops often include exercises in creating Game Design Documents (GDDs) or smaller design briefs. This teaches participants to articulate their vision clearly, defining mechanics, narrative, and technical requirements—a crucial skill for professional communication.

Accessing Game Design Workshop Opportunities
The burgeoning demand for skilled game developers has led to a widespread availability of game design workshops, making the primary challenge one of selection based on individual needs and preferences. A wealth of opportunities exists across various platforms:
- Educational Institutions: Many dedicated game design schools and university departments regularly host workshops, often as standalone programs or as extensions of their formal curricula. These can range from summer intensives to weekend bootcamps.
- Community Centers and Creative Hubs: Local community organizations and art centers increasingly offer game design workshops as part of their vocational training or creative enrichment programs, often catering to diverse age groups and skill levels.
- Online Learning Platforms: The digital landscape provides expanded access to high-quality workshops. Platforms like Coursera, Udemy, edX, and specialized game development academies offer a wide range of online, instructor-led workshops, often with flexible schedules and global reach.
- Industry Events and Conventions: Major gaming conventions (e.g., GDC, PAX, EGX) and smaller industry meetups frequently feature workshops, masterclasses, and hands-on sessions led by leading professionals, providing cutting-edge insights and networking opportunities.
- Professional Networking Platforms: Websites like Meetup.com host numerous groups focused on game design and development. These groups often share information about upcoming local workshops, game jams, and collaborative projects. LinkedIn can also be a valuable resource for finding professional development opportunities.
